This is a list of political parties in South Africa. South Africa is a democratic but one-party dominant state with the African National Congress in power.

Parties represented in Parliament

Party Also known as National Assembly seats[1]
African Christian Democratic Party ACDP 4
African Independent Congress AIC 2
African Transformation Movement ATM 2
Al Jama-ah ALJAMAH 1
African National Congress ANC 230
Congress of the People COPE 2
Democratic Alliance DA 84
Economic Freedom Fighters EFF 44
Freedom Front Plus FF+ 10
Good GOOD 2
Inkatha Freedom Party IFP 14
National Freedom Party NFP 2
Pan Africanist Congress PAC 1
United Democratic Movement UDM 2
